Subject: Lyr Add: A BEAUTIFUL LIFE (William M. Golden) From: Jim Dixon Date: 16 Mar 03 - 12:18 AM Lyrics copied from http://members.tripod.com/Synergy_2/lyrics/beautlif.html (There is also a midi at that site.) A BEAUTIFUL LIFE (Words & Music by William M. Golden, 1918) Each day I'll do a golden deed, By helping those who are in need. My life on earth is but a span, And so I'll do the best I can. CHORUS: Life's evening sun is sinking low. A few more days and I must go To meet the deeds that I have done, Where there will be no setting sun. To be a child of God each day, My light must shine along the way. I'll sing His praise while ages roll And strive to help some troubled soul. CHORUS The only life that will endure Is one that's kind and good and pure. And so for God I'll take my stand. Each day I'll lend a helping hand. CHORUS I'll help someone in time of need, And journey on with rapid speed. I'll help the sick and poor and weak, And words of kindness to them speak. CHORUS While going down life's weary road, I'll try to lift some traveler's load. I'll try to turn the night to day, Make flowers bloom along the way. CHORUS [In every sample I have listened to, this song is sung in call-and-response fashion, e.g. "Each day I'll do (each day I'll do) a golden deed (a golden deed), By helping those (by helping those) who are in need (who are in need)... etc." [Recorded by the Bass Mountain Boys, Bryan Bowers, the Chuck Wagon Gang, the Country Gentlemen, Tennessee Ernie Ford, the Hee Haw Gospel Quartet, Kazuhiro Inaba, the Kentucky Colonels, Del McCoury, Bill Monroe, Jim Reeves, Tex Ritter, Red Smiley, the Stanley Brothers, the Statler Brothers, Carl Storey, and T. Texas Tyler.] |
